A 3-Day City Experience in Varanasi

Friday, October 20, 2023: Explore Ancient Temples

In the morning, start your day with a visit to the renowned Kashi Vishwanath Tem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va. Experience the spiritual atmosphere as you witness devotees performing rituals. Afterward, head to the Dashashwamedh Ghat for a boat ride on the River Ganges. Witness the mesmerizing Ganga Aarti ceremony in the evening at this ghat, where priests offer prayers with oil lamps.

  • Kashi Vishwanath Temple: Free, 2 hours
  • Dashashwamedh Ghat: Boat Ride - INR 200 ($3), 1.5 hours
  • Ganga Aarti at Dashashwamedh Ghat: Free, 1 hour
Saturday, October 21, 2023: Cultural Exploration

In the morning, visit the Sarnath Archaeological Site where Lord Buddha preached his first sermon. Explore the Dhamek Stupa and the Ashoka Pillar. In the afternoon, wander through the narrow lanes of Varanasi's old city, stopping at the Vishwanath Gali for some shopping. As evening approaches, indulge in a traditional Bhojpuri dance performance at a local theater.

  • Sarnath Archaeological Site: Entry Fee - INR 30 ($0.5), 2 hours
  • Vishwanath Gali: Shopping - Varies, 1.5 hours
  • Bhojpuri Dance Performance: Ticket - INR 500 ($7), 2 hours
Sunday, October 22, 2023: Vibrant Varanasi

Start your day by witnessing a mesmerizing sunrise boat ride on the Ganges. Observe the ghats coming alive with various activities like yoga, bathing, and spiritual ceremonies. Afterward, explore the colorful and bustling markets of Varanasi, including the popular Godaulia Market. In the evening, treat yourself to a delectable street food experience at the Kachori Gali.

  • Sunrise Boat Ride: Boat Ride - INR 300 ($4), 2 hours
  • Godaulia Market: Shopping - Varies, 2 hours
  • Kachori Gali: Street Food - Varies, 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ique experience, explore the narrow alleys of Varanasi's old city, known as "galis," where you can witness the local way of life. Don't miss the chance to visit the Manikarnika Ghat, one of the oldest cremation ghats in Varanasi. Another off-the-beaten-path attraction is the Ramnagar Fort, situated on the banks of the River Ganges and known for its stunning architecture and museum.
